CoffeeMachine.cs
Source: CoffeeMachine.cs
...6using Microsoft.Coyote.Samples.Common;7using static Microsoft.Coyote.Samples.CoffeeMachineActors.FailoverDriver;8namespace Microsoft.Coyote.Samples.CoffeeMachineActors9{10 [OnEventDoAction(typeof(TerminateEvent), nameof(OnTerminate))]11 internal class CoffeeMachine : StateMachine12 {13 private ActorId Client;14 private ActorId WaterTank;15 private ActorId CoffeeGrinder;16 private ActorId DoorSensor;17 private readonly LogWriter Log = LogWriter.Instance;18 internal class ConfigEvent : Event19 {20 public ActorId WaterTank;21 public ActorId CoffeeGrinder;22 public ActorId Client;23 public ActorId DoorSensor;24 public ConfigEvent(ActorId waterTank, ActorId coffeeGrinder, ActorId doorSensor, ActorId client)25 {26 this.WaterTank = waterTank;27 this.CoffeeGrinder = coffeeGrinder;28 this.Client = client;29 this.DoorSensor = doorSensor;30 }31 }32 internal class MakeCoffeeEvent : Event33 {34 public int Shots;35 public MakeCoffeeEvent(int shots)36 {37 this.Shots = shots;38 }39 }40 internal class CoffeeCompletedEvent : Event41 {42 public bool Error;43 }44 internal class TerminateEvent : Event { }45 internal class HaltedEvent : Event { }46 [Start]47 [OnEntry(nameof(OnInit))]48 [DeferEvents(typeof(MakeCoffeeEvent))]49 private class Init : State { }50 private void OnInit(Event e)51 {52 if (e is ConfigEvent configEvent)53 {54 this.Log.WriteLine("initializing...");55 this.Client = configEvent.Client;56 this.WaterTank = configEvent.WaterTank;57 this.CoffeeGrinder = configEvent.CoffeeGrinder;58 this.DoorSensor = configEvent.DoorSensor;59 this.RaiseGotoStateEvent<Check>60 }61 }62 [OnEntry(nameof(OnError))]63 private class Error : State { }64 private void OnError()65 {66 if (this.Client != null)67 {68 this.SendEvent(this.Client, new CoffeeCompletedEvent() { Error = true });69 }70 }71 private void OnTerminate(Event e)72 {73 if (e is TerminateEvent te)74 {75 this.Log.WriteLine("Coffee Machine Terminating...");76 // better turn everything off then!77 }78 }79 }80}...
